首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

构建用于Swift的FFmpeg

是指在Swift编程语言中集成FFmpeg多媒体处理工具库的过程。FFmpeg是一个跨平台的开源项目,提供了处理音频、视频和流媒体的丰富功能和工具。通过将FFmpeg与Swift结合使用,可以在Swift应用程序中进行各种多媒体处理操作,如解码、编码、转码、剪辑、合并、截图等。

FFmpeg可用于多个平台和设备,并且提供了许多优秀的功能和特性,因此在构建用于Swift的FFmpeg时需要考虑以下方面:

  1. 概念:FFmpeg是一个开源的多媒体处理工具库,它由一组用C语言编写的库和工具组成,可以用于处理音频、视频和流媒体数据。
  2. 分类:FFmpeg可分为多个组件和模块,包括解码器、编码器、滤镜、格式转换器等,每个组件都有特定的功能和用途。
  3. 优势:FFmpeg具有广泛的应用领域和丰富的功能,如视频剪辑、格式转换、音频提取、视频合成等。它还支持多种音视频编码格式和协议,具有良好的兼容性和稳定性。
  4. 应用场景:构建用于Swift的FFmpeg可以应用于多媒体处理领域,如视频编辑应用、音频处理应用、实时流媒体传输等。它可以用于开发各种多媒体应用,满足用户对多媒体处理的需求。
  5. 推荐的腾讯云相关产品和产品介绍链接地址:腾讯云提供了丰富的云计算产品和服务,其中涵盖了多媒体处理相关的功能。以下是一些推荐的腾讯云产品:
    • 腾讯云媒体处理(云点播):提供了音视频转码、剪辑、水印、截图等功能,可用于构建多媒体处理应用。详细信息请参考:腾讯云媒体处理(云点播)
    • 腾讯云移动直播(云直播):提供了实时音视频传输和处理的能力,可用于构建直播应用。详细信息请参考:腾讯云移动直播(云直播)
    • 腾讯云音视频解决方案:提供了丰富的音视频处理和传输解决方案,包括音视频通话、实时音视频互动等。详细信息请参考:腾讯云音视频解决方案

通过以上腾讯云产品和服务,可以方便地构建用于Swift的FFmpeg,并实现各种多媒体处理需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分16秒

想象用于视频的 Adobe Firefly

3分59秒

08.创建用于测试的Maven工程.avi

3分9秒

37.创建用于功能扩展的接口和实现类.avi

2分3秒

32.尚硅谷_Subversion_创建用于测试的Eclipse工程.avi

2分28秒

基于CRISPRCas9技术开发的用于肿瘤突变负荷(TMB)测量的新型FFPE

10分54秒

03.构建的概念.avi

3分12秒

【玩转 WordPress】快速构建专属的博客

9.8K
36秒

自动化测试系统用于CFD分析软件,调用的求解器是SU2

8分41秒

21-容器化构建的几种方式

13分42秒

2.7 自然语言查询的UI构建

-

机器学习已成熟:谷歌组建一个新团队,欲将应用于核心的器件产品

8分6秒

6-依赖预构建的esbuild与缓存

领券